FISHING STUDY ON ITS WAY IN TURKS AND CAICOS WATERS

TURKS AND CAICOS ISLANDS, OCTOBER 22, 2013- A UK sponsored pelagic fishing study started in the Turks and Caicos Islands last Friday. The study by Caicos Pride in South Caicos is using a long line fishing method, and will determine the economic feasibility of developing an off-shore fisheries industry for the TCI. The vessel being used in the study brought in its first haul yesterday, which includes swordfish, mahi mahi, wahoo, big-eye tuna, yellow fin tuna and albacore. A DEMA observer is aboard the vessel and DEMA says it is able to monitor activities via virtual software.

When asked about yesterday’s activities, DEMA Director Kathleen Wood said they are well pleased that all proceedings are going as agreed. The department added that once the first voyage is completed, DEMA will be releasing all of the statistical data from the catch.
